VHP files case against Karunanidhi

via HK published on September 26, 2007

MUMBAI : Vishwa Hindu Parishad today filed a case in Mumbai against Tamil Nadu Chief Minister M. Karunanidhi for deliberately hurting  the sentiments of crores of Hindus in the country by insulting Lord Sri Ram.


 


VHP Secretary Prof. Venkatesh Abdeo said the case has been filed under IPC section 295 A and 153 A in the Borivali Metropolitan Court of Magistrate N.H. Mohabe.


 


The case has been filed by VHP Mumbai secretary Arun Handa.


 


The hearing of the case has been fixed on October 5.
